PDO Thread FAQs
Do PDO threads cause scar tissue?Threads do cause a minimal amount of micro-scarring which helps create a stronger and longer-lasting lift. The micro-scarring that occurs with PDO threads is actually beneficial to your lift and is less than the micro-scarring you get with other treatments such as biostimulatory fillers, RF microneedling, etc. The micro-scarring that occurs will not cause any negative effects even for future surgical treatments. Are PDO threads permanent?PDO threads are not permanent but dissolve into the skin over time. How long does PDO last?The threads typically last about 9 months to a year at which point they start to dissolve but the lift will last a little longer due to the collagen that was produced during that time period. Can PDO threads move?Barbed or lifting threads do have the possibility to move or migrate but it is not common especially when they are placed in the correct plane, and the patient follows appropriate aftercare instructions. Can you remove PDO threads?Yes, they can be removed very easily in the office if necessary but that’s not usually done. Does PDO thread lift hurt?We ensure a comfortable treatment by numbing the entire area before starting the procedure, so the treatment itself should be very comfortable. Once the numbing starts to wear off, the initial discomfort will start. The tenderness/soreness will be the most intense during the first 3 days, then the discomfort will become more moderate from days 4-14 at which point the discomfort will transition from mild to sporadic until 4-6 weeks out. How do PDO threads work?PDO threads work by physically lifting the tissue and repositioning the fat pads in the face. Once lifted the threads will cause the body to create collagen, elastin, and micro scarring which will help lift further and ensure a longer-lasting lift. The threads typically start to dissolve around 9 months out and the lift will continue to stay up for about 1-1.5 years out, while the collagen that was created will typically last 3-5 years. How long does a thread lift last?The lift will typically last about 1-1.5 years and the collagen that was produced will last about 3-5 years. Maintenance can be done around 1 year.
